The Cottage Cafe by La Polo has officially opened its doors in the heart of Central Delhi.

Located on Janpath Road inside the Cottage Emporium near Janpath Metro Station, this cafe is a haven for those who appreciate aesthetics and tranquillity.

Inspired by the rich history of polo, known as the “sport of kings,” the cafe infuses a touch of royal elegance into every corner.

The Cottage Cafe promises to be the new favourite spot for people looking to unwind in style amidst the city’s hustle and bustle.

Upon entering, you are greeted by polo-inspired wall art that sets the tone for a unique experience. The interiors feature Indian cane crafted, minimalist furniture that adds an authentic, aesthetic vibe to the space. The ambience strikes a balance between European comfort and Indian classic drama, creating a cosy environment.

The mix of warm, neutral tones with touches of greenery and natural materials adds to the serene atmosphere, making it a perfect spot to relax or have a casual meeting.

A retreat with exceptional coffee and breakfast

For coffee enthusiasts, The Cottage Cafe offers a wide range of options, each cup brewed using the finest coffee beans with various milk choices to match every preference. Whether it’s a strong espresso or a creamy latte, the cafe caters to all tastes. It’s a place where every sip offers a moment of calm, perfectly complementing the tranquil ambience of the café

Beyond its coffee selection, The Cottage Cafe’s breakfast menu, crafted by chef Manish Kashyap, has become quite popular.

“Our breakfast menu is getting a lot of love; we have customers asking for breakfast platters even during lunch or dinner time,” General Manager Ashish Gupta told The Patriot.

His focus on fresh ingredients and creative twists on familiar dishes makes the breakfast offerings stand out.

One of the standout dishes is the Persian Shakshuka Skillet, featuring poached eggs nestled on a bed of spiced onion and tomato sauce. The combination of tangy and rich flavours, along with the silky texture of the eggs, makes it a comforting yet bold breakfast choice.

Another favourite is the Mushroom and Cheese Omelette, filled with cheddar cheese and sautéed mushrooms. This fluffy omelette offers a savoury and creamy bite, evoking the warmth of a home-cooked meal. It’s a dish that brings simplicity and elegance to the table, reminiscent of a classic recipe perfected over time.

For those who enjoy a bit of spice, the Gochujang Sloppy Joe is a must-try. This dish combines grilled chicken coated in tangy gochujang sauce, cheddar cheese, caramelised onions, and fresh lettuce, all nestled between soft buns. It’s a fusion of sweet, spicy, and savoury flavours that offers an adventurous yet comforting experience.

The menu also features the Peri Peri Chicken, a dish bursting with flavours. The peri peri-marinated chicken, paired with sundried tomatoes and mozzarella cheese, creates a delicious play of spicy and tangy notes. The heat from the peri peri sauce is balanced by the richness of the cheese, making each bite a delightful journey.

For a lunch choice, the Grilled Fish is good to go. Marinated in herbs, the fish is grilled to perfection, maintaining a delicate yet firm texture. It is served with sautéed vegetables, roasted potatoes, and a creamy olive tapenade sauce. This dish is perfect for those who enjoy a classic and subtle dining experience.

Ashish added, “It’s been three months since The Cottage Cafe opened. While there are many happening places around Connaught Place and Janpath, we wanted to provide a perfectly blissful, comfortable, and sober cafe experience for our visitors. The cosy ambience, curated with minimalistic colours—mainly black and white—is inspired by polo, the royal game.”
